3 / 3 page page date DESCRIPTION: dc-dc converter 3 of 3 02/2008 20050 SW 112th Ave. Tualatin, Oregon 97062 phone phone 503.612.2300 fax fax 503.612.2382 PART NUMBER: VAT0.25-SMT Series Application Notes: - To ensure this module can operate efficiently and reliably during operation, the minimum output load should not be less than 10% of the full load. This product should never be operated under no load conditions. If the actual output power is very low you should increase the load by connecting a resistor with the proper resistance at the output end in parallel. - Recommended Circuit If you want to further decrease the input/output ripple, an “LC” filtering network may be connected to the input and output ends of the dc-dc converter, see (Figure 1). - Overload Protection Under normal operating conditions, the output circuit of these products has no protection against overload. The simplest method is to connect a self-recovery fuse in series at the input end or add a circuit breaker to the circuit.
